Fears of ‘diarrhea salad’ amid cyclospora outbreak prompt New Yorkers to skip leafy greens for cooked food

A Cyclosporiasis outbreak in New York City has infected 374 people, prompting residents to avoid leafy greens and fresh vegetables linked to the parasite. Experts advise discarding suspect produce and opting for cooked foods, while health departments struggle to trace the source due to the parasite's long incubation period.
